    How can I restart the pc from the USB flash drive?
      My Computer


  8. Posts : 15,026
    Windows 10 Home 64Bit
       #18

    kaitlynalexa said:
    How can I restart the pc from the USB flash drive?
    Hold the boot menu key during boot up, it will list up the possible places to boot from. Select the USB device using up\down arrow, and enter.

    Otherwise enter into bios and set USB device as first boot drive, accept, exit and restart. :)
